Lacrosse Practice Began Yesterday.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

About twenty men reported for the first fall lacrosse practice on Holmes Field yesterday afternoon. The practice consisted of stick work and other rudimentary points of the game. J. A. Sayler 3L., Captain Phillips, P. H. Adams '05 and S. Smith 3L., coached the men.

Men who have played in former years and also new men are urged to come out for this fall work in order that they may not be handicapped when the spring practice begins. Practice will be held every afternoon at 4 o'clock. It will continue to be elementary for several days, after which short daily line-ups will be held and about November 1 a team will be picked to play a team of graduates.
